Analysis

The most recent figure for gni per capita in Iran is 2.91 billion current LCU,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.

That represents a change of up 24.0% on the previous year and up 1,883.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gni per capita in Iran peaked at 2.91 billion current LCU in 2025 and was at its lowest, 14,441 current LCU, in 1960.

Iran ranks 1st of 209 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 18,226 current LCU 14,441 current LCU 25,050 current LCU 10
1970s 96,458 current LCU 27,350 current LCU 167,283 current LCU 10
1980s 308,747 current LCU 171,094 current LCU 479,961 current LCU 10
1990s 3.19 million current LCU 650,402 current LCU 7.28 million current LCU 10
2000s 28.76 million current LCU 9.47 million current LCU 53.71 million current LCU 10
2010s 165.81 million current LCU 65.06 million current LCU 328.38 million current LCU 10
2020s 1.60 billion current LCU 498.36 million current LCU 2.91 billion current LCU 6

Gross national income is the total income earned by all residents within an economic territory during an accounting period. It is equal to gross domestic product plus earned income receivable from abroad minus earned income payable abroad. The core indicator has been divided by the general population to achieve a per capita estimate.This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This series is expressed in local currency units.
